Preserve cooling discipline at the rack face with a thermal kit door designed for Vertiv BCM2000 environments. In dense infrastructure, front-door airflow control can be the difference between stable operation and avoidable thermal drift. This 42U x 19 kit supports that control by helping separate intake and exhaust paths at the enclosure level.
For teams managing mixed loads, the value is not cosmetic. It is about keeping conditioned air where it belongs, reducing bypass, and giving the cooling system a more predictable load profile. That matters in rooms where every degree and every watt of cooling capacity is already accounted for.
